The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au on Thursday took another shot at the credit card industry, saying that the Annual Percentage Rate (APR) on credit cards has almost doubled over the past decade, making the cards extremely expensive for consumers and highly profitable for financial institutions. “By some measures, credit cards have never been this expensive,” the agency said in a new industry analysis.

African-American Credit Union Coalition President/CEO Renée Sattiewhite and I partnered to set the record straight against recent bank attacks: Credit unions will never apologize for putting people over profit. Calls for expanding the Community Reinvestment Act (CRA) miss the point that the CRA was created to stop banks from redlining and other discriminatory practices, while credit unions have a demonstrated legacy of serving those banks leave behind.
